无人机倾斜摄影技术在地震烈度评估中的应用——以九寨沟7.0级地震为例

摘    要:以九寨沟7.0级地震为例,通过阐述无人机倾斜摄影技术的相关原理,说明该技术在地震烈度评估中的应用价值。结果表明,使用无人机倾斜摄影技术不仅能够直观地、全方位地展示震害信息,同时,还能对裂缝、滑坡等几何信息进行量测,为烈度评估等提供更加精确的信息。

The application of oblique photography technology in seismic intensity assessment-Taking the Jiuzhaigou MS7.0 earthquake as an example

Abstract:This paper illustrates the application of UAV oblique photography in seismic intensity assessment by describing the relevant principles in the case of the Jiuzhaigou MS7.0 earthquake. The results proved UAV oblique photography can not only show the earthquake damage information intuitively and comprehensively, but also measure cracks, landslides and other geometric information, and all of these provide more accurate information for the intensity evaluation.
